[PATCH] i386: replace intermediate array-size definitions with ARRAY_SIZE()
Code is easier to validate if array sizes aren't hidden behind extra #defines. Signed-off-by: Bjorn Helgaas <bjorn.helgaas@hp.com> Signed-off-by: Andi Kleen <ak@suse.de>
